Darshan Patel
MY RESUME
👨‍💻 Professional Summary

Full Stack Java Developer with 3+ years of hands-on experience building and deploying secure, data-driven web applications across retail, e-commerce, and enterprise cloud environments. Skilled in designing dynamic, responsive frontends using Angular, TypeScript, JavaScript (ES6+), HTML5, CSS3, and Bootstrap, focusing on clean UI, reusability, and performance. Experienced in backend engineering with Java, Spring Boot, Hibernate, RESTful APIs, and Microservices, delivering scalable business logic and seamless integration across layers. Strong exposure to SQL and NoSQL databases including SQL Server, MongoDB, MySQL, and IBM DB2, with schema design, stored procedures, and data optimization. Comfortable with cloud platforms and DevOps tooling such as AWS, Azure Cloud Services, Pivotal Cloud Foundry, Jenkins, Docker, Git, and GitHub Actions, ensuring smooth CI/CD automation and deployment. Familiar with production monitoring and alerting through Splunk, New Relic, ServiceNow, PagerDuty, and SAS. Agile Scrum practitioner focused on application reliability and uptime in live environments.

🛠️ Technical Skills
  • Languages

    Java, JavaScript (ES6+), TypeScript, SQL, HTML5, CSS3, JSON
  • Frontend

    Angular, Bootstrap, CSS, jQuery, AJAX, Responsive Design
  • Backend

    Java, Spring Boot, Spring MVC, Hibernate, JSP, Servlets, JDBC, RESTful APIs, Microservices, RabbitMQ
  • Databases

    SQL Server, MongoDB, MySQL, IBM DB2, Oracle
  • Cloud Platforms

    AWS (EC2, S3), Azure Cloud Services, Pivotal Cloud Foundry (PCF)
  • DevOps & CI/CD

    Jenkins, Docker, Git, GitHub Actions, Maven, CI/CD Pipelines
  • Monitoring & Logging

    Splunk, New Relic, ServiceNow, PagerDuty, SAS
  • Testing & QA

    JUnit, Postman, Unit & Integration Testing
  • Tools & IDEs

    IntelliJ IDEA, Eclipse, VS Code, Postman, Jira, Confluence
  • Practices

    Agile Scrum, SDLC, TDD, Version Control, Code Reviews, Pair Programming
🎓 Education
May 2017
Bachelor of Science in Computer Engineering - New Jersey Institute of Technology – Newark, NJ
👨‍💼 Professional Experience
Jan 2022 – Present
Full Stack Java Developer – GAP Inc., San Francisco, CA
  • Worked on the inventory application development team supporting multiple web platforms across regions.
  • Built and optimized web applications that streamlined order processing, product management, and distribution.
  • Developed interactive, responsive Angular components integrated with Java Spring Boot APIs for live product catalogs and sizing systems used by distribution centers.
  • Designed and implemented RESTful APIs using Spring Boot to manage product details and user authentication modules with brand-specific access control.
  • Improved backend performance by optimizing Hibernate entities, fine‑tuning SQL Server queries, and applying indexing strategies.
  • Implemented RabbitMQ for asynchronous communication between microservices, ensuring real‑time order and inventory updates.
  • Deployed applications to Azure App Services and Pivotal Cloud Foundry for staging environments.
  • Configured and maintained CI/CD pipelines with Jenkins and Docker, automating builds, tests, and deployments.
  • Monitored system health and performance using Splunk and New Relic, integrating alerts with ServiceNow and PagerDuty.
  • Collaborated with UX designers and business analysts in Agile sprints to align technical solutions with business‑user requirements.
  • Conducted unit and integration testing using JUnit and Postman, ensuring smooth release cycles and high‑quality deliverables.
📚 Programs & Training
Oct 2019 – Feb 2021
Full Stack Java Developer Bootcamp – DevMountain Technologies

Completed a comprehensive bootcamp program focused on full‑stack application development using Java, Spring Boot, Angular, and SQL. Learned Agile practices, CI/CD with Jenkins, and Git‑based collaboration while building real‑world prototypes for e‑commerce and data management applications. Covered OOP, REST API creation, and cloud deployments (AWS, Azure).

🎓 Education
May 2019
Master of Science in Computer Science - New York Institute of Technology, NY

Graduated with a GPA of 3.7/4.0, specializing in software engineering, databases, and cloud computing.

May 2017
Bachelor of Engineering in Computer Science - Gujarat Technological University, India

Achieved a GPA of 3.7/4.0 with a strong foundation in software development, algorithms, and systems design.

My Skills

LANGUAGES

95
Java
90
JavaScript / TypeScript
85
Spring Boot / Quarkus
80
React / Angular

CLOUD & DEVOPS

  • AWS / Azure / GCP

    85%
  • Docker / Kubernetes

    90%
  • CI/CD (Jenkins, GitHub Actions)

    80%

DATABASES

  • Oracle / PostgreSQL / MySQL

    85%
  • MongoDB / Cassandra

    75%
  • JDBC / Query Optimization

    80%
🌟 Character Traits
  • Analytical Thinker

  • Collaborative Leader

  • Adaptable & Curious

  • Quality & Security Driven